Weir Mill Farm Bed & Breakfast - Cullompton
50.88885, -3.36236Located merely 0.9 miles from Tiverton Junction, Weir Mill Farm Bed & Breakfast Cullompton features Wi-Fi in all rooms and free private parking on site.
Location
Jaycroft is located in the immediate vicinity of this 4-star hotel, and Exeter International airport is approximately a 24-minute drive away. Sights about 10 minutes by car from the Cullompton bed & breakfast include Parish Church of St Mary. You can easily find Diggerland 1.3 miles from the Cullompton property.
The hotel is also situated only a short drive from Uffculme Turn bus stop.
Rooms
The rooms comprise a seating area complete with an iron with ironing board, as well as high-speed internet and a flat-screen TV with satellite channels. The bathroom features a separate toilet and a shower, along with a hairdryer and bath sheets.
